Ad of the Week: Chemistry’s Get Cancer Campaign for Irish Cancer Society

Chemistry has created a new provocative campaign for the Irish Cancer Society aimed at kick-starting the conversation about cancer. The Get Cancer campaign features a host of real life cancer survivors who state that they want to get cancer. The ad was directed by Keith Hutchinson of H2 Films.
